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
46927604209 57357837178 28550 7567937 8116837
738307996 386 63180695420
738307996 386 63180695420
410 911468824 8908942704
All about undefined
Interested in learning more?
738307996 386 63180695420
410 911468824 8908942704
See more
63408 5280871915 549468864
54327550 92353 191
See more
50017106 3355437
991546 0684 9956141541 7589201 51
See more